Popularity of the Surname Lingeman

The surname Lingeman is not as common as some other surnames, but it can still be found in several countries around the world. According to data from various countries, the incidence of the surname Lingeman is as follows:

  • United States (US): 272 occurrences
  • Netherlands (NL): 199 occurrences
  • Canada (CA): 17 occurrences
  • England (GB-ENG): 7 occurrences
  • Germany (DE): 6 occurrences
  • Australia (AU): 2 occurrences
  • Belgium (BE): 1 occurrence

Variations of the Surname Lingeman

Like many surnames, the surname Lingeman may have undergone variations over time due to factors such as regional dialects, spelling variations, and pronunciation differences. Some common variations of the surname Lingeman include:

  • Lingemann
  • Leingeman
  • Lingman
  • Lenigman

It is important to keep in mind these variations when conducting genealogical research or searching for information about individuals with the surname Lingeman, as these alternate spellings may have been used interchangeably at different points in history.
